Factors Affecting Cost

  • Material Quality: Higher-end materials like cedar or redwood will cost more than pressure-treated lumber.
  • Project Size: Larger projects naturally require more materials and labor, increasing the overall cost.
  • Complexity: Intricate designs or custom features will add to the labor costs.
  • Permits and Regulations: Local building codes and necessary permits can add to the expense.
  • Labor Rates: The cost of labor can vary based on the contractor's experience and demand in the area.
  • Seasonality: Prices may fluctuate depending on the time of year, with peak seasons potentially costing more.
  • Site Preparation: Additional costs may be incurred if the site needs significant preparation, like leveling or clearing.

Average Costs for Common Tasks

Task Average Cost (Colorado Springs, CO)
Deck Installation (per sq ft) $15 - $35
Pergola Construction $2,000 - $5,000
Custom Wood Fencing (per linear foot) $15 - $45
Gazebo Construction $3,000 - $10,000
Outdoor Kitchen Carpentry $5,000 - $20,000
Patio Cover Installation $1,500 - $4,500
Trellis or Arbor $500 - $2,500
Wooden Retaining Wall $20 - $50 per sq ft
